Correlation functions in the D1-D5 orbifold CFT
Abstract
The D1-D5 system has an orbifold point in its moduli space, at which it may be described by an supersymmetric sigma model with target space where is or . In this paper we consider correlation functions involving chiral operators constructed from twist fields: we find explicit expressions for processes involving a twist operator joining twist operators of arbitrary twist. These expressions are universal, in that they are independent of the choice of , and the final results can be expressed in a compact form. We explain how these results are relevant to the black hole microstate programme: one point functions of chiral operators can be used to reconstruct AdS near horizon regions of D1-D5 microstates and to match microstates constructed in supergravity with the CFT.
